What brand is similar to Kenmore?
Most top-freezer Kenmore fridges are made by Electrolux, and are similar to Frigidaire models. Most side-by-side and some inexpensive French door models are made by Whirlpool, while nearly all high-end French door and some side-by-side models are made by LG.

Where is Whirlpool made?
In its domestic, United States, market Whirlpool has nine manufacturing facilities: Amana, Iowa; Tulsa, Oklahoma; Cleveland, Tennessee; Clyde, Ohio; Findlay, Ohio; Greenville, Ohio; Marion, Ohio; Ottawa, Ohio; and Fall River, Massachusetts.

Does Sears make Whirlpool?
Sears Holdings will no longer sell Whirlpool’s products, which include Whirlpool’s Maytag, KitchenAid and Jenn-Air subsidiaries, according to an internal Sears memo. The department store chain cited a dispute between the two companies over pricing.
Does the Kenmore brand still exist?
The demise of the once-storied Kenmore appliance brand is the perfect embodiment of Sears’ collapse. At the start of this century, Kenmore was one of the top appliance brands in the country, and was only available at Sears stores. Sears was the largest seller of other appliance brands too, and it dominated that market.
